The University of Essex, based at Wivenhoe Park, Colchester, received
its Royal Charter in 1965. It is one of the UK's leading academic
institutions and has an international reputation for the quality
of its research and teaching. The University has 16 departments
spanning the Humanities, Social Sciences and Science and Engineering.
Famous
past students from Essex include BBC foreign correspondent Brian
Hanrahan; Mrs Virginia Bottomley; the former President of Costa
Rica and 1987 Nobel Peace Prize Winner, Dr Oscar Arias; the Chief
Constable of Warwickshire, Mr Peter Joslin; Mexico's first and only
astronaut, Dr Rodolfo Neri Vela; and Booker Prize Winner, Ben Okri.
